是一种常见的配置,用于在web应用程序中使用数据库。下面是一个完善且全面的答案:
MYSQL是一种开源的关系型数据库管理系统,它提供了可靠的数据存储和高效的数据检索功能。连接MYSQL数据库到webserver服务器可以实现数据的持久化存储和访问。
连接MYSQL到webserver服务器的步骤如下:
- 安装MYSQL数据库:首先需要在服务器上安装MYSQL数据库。可以通过官方网站下载并按照指示进行安装。
- 配置MYSQL数据库:安装完成后,需要进行一些基本的配置,如设置root用户密码、创建数据库等。
- 配置webserver服务器:接下来,需要在webserver服务器上配置与MYSQL数据库的连接。具体配置方式取决于所使用的webserver服务器,如Apache、Nginx等。
- 安装数据库驱动程序:在webserver服务器上安装适用于所使用编程语言的MYSQL数据库驱动程序。不同编程语言可能有不同的驱动程序,如PHP使用mysqli或PDO。
- 编写代码连接数据库:在web应用程序中,使用编程语言提供的MYSQL数据库驱动程序,编写代码连接到MYSQL数据库。这包括指定数据库的主机名、用户名、密码等连接参数。
- 执行数据库操作:连接成功后,可以执行各种数据库操作,如查询、插入、更新、删除等。这些操作可以通过编程语言提供的MYSQL数据库API来实现。
MYSQL连接到webserver服务器的优势包括:
- 可靠性和稳定性:MYSQL是一种成熟的数据库管理系统,具有良好的稳定性和可靠性,适用于各种规模的应用程序。
- 数据安全性:MYSQL提供了多种安全机制,如用户认证、权限管理等,可以保护数据库中的数据免受未经授权的访问。
- 高性能:MYSQL具有高效的查询和数据处理能力,可以处理大量的并发请求,并提供快速的响应时间。
- 跨平台支持:MYSQL可以在各种操作系统上运行,包括Windows、Linux、macOS等。
MYSQL连接到webserver服务器的应用场景包括:
- 网站和Web应用程序:MYSQL广泛应用于网站和Web应用程序中,用于存储和管理用户数据、产品信息、日志等。
- 电子商务平台:MYSQL可用于构建电子商务平台,用于存储和管理商品信息、订单数据、用户账户等。
- 社交媒体应用:MYSQL可用于存储和管理社交媒体应用中的用户信息、帖子、评论等。
- 数据分析和报表:MYSQL可以用于存储和管理大量的数据,支持数据分析和生成报表。
腾讯云提供了一系列与MYSQL相关的产品和服务,包括云数据库MySQL、云数据库TencentDB for MySQL等。这些产品提供了高可用性、高性能的MYSQL数据库服务,可以满足各种应用场景的需求。
更多关于腾讯云MYSQL产品的信息,请访问腾讯云官方网站:腾讯云MYSQL产品介绍